The role of insulin and glucagon in the regulation of basal glucose production in the postabsorptive dog.

TL;DR: In this paper, the role of insulin and glucagon in the regulation of basal glucose production in dogs fasted overnight was investigated and it was shown that insulin deficiency resulted in a 52+/-16% (P less than 0.01) increase in the rate of glucose production which was abolished when the insulin level was restored.
